Nothing will ever outdo the original. 

It had everything. The roster, the coaches, the fights and the drama in the house were all perfect.

UFC greats Forrest Griffin, Stephan Bonnar, Chris Leben, Diego Sanchez, Nate Quarry, Kenny Florian and Josh Koscheck highlighted the all star cast with Leben providing most of the drama. Throw in two of the greatest fighters of all time, Chuck Liddell and Randy Couture, as their head coaches, and you've got yourself must-see television.

What made this season special was the fact that it showed the masses that these Mixed Martial Artists aren't barbarians, and though they might have a few problems, they are regular people. Oh, and it introduced the world to the brash personality of UFC president Dana White with his famous "do you want to be a f****** fighter?" speech.

But as you know, the reason I'm able to post an article like this on a mainstream sports news site is because of the legendary scrap between Griffin and Bonnar in the finale. It started the boom for MMA.
